Overview
The Master of Physiotherapy (MPT) is a postgraduate degree designed to transform Bachelor of Physiotherapy graduates into specialized, evidence-based practitioners. This advanced program deepens clinical skills and knowledge in a chosen specialization, preparing graduates for leadership roles in healthcare and academia.

Why Study This Course?
Market Demand:
High/10
- Specialize in high-demand areas like Orthopedics, Neurology, Pediatrics, or Sports Physiotherapy.
- Gain advanced clinical reasoning, diagnostic, and therapeutic intervention skills.
- Enhance research capabilities through thesis work and scholarly projects.
- Open doors to leadership, teaching, and specialized clinical practice roles.
Who should study?
Aspiring physiotherapists who have completed a BPT and wish to gain in-depth knowledge and specialized skills in a particular area of physiotherapy to advance their clinical practice, pursue research, or take on academic roles.
Eligibility & Admission
Minimum Qualification:
Bachelor of Physiotherapy (BPT) degree or equivalent from a recognized university with a minimum aggregate score of 50% (relaxation for reserved categories as per norms).

Selection Criteria:
Merit-based on BPT marks, entrance exam scores, and sometimes interviews. Government institutions typically have highly competitive entrance exams.

Career Opportunities
Private Sector Scope
Top Industries: Multi-specialty Hospitals,
Rehabilitation Centers,
Sports Clinics,
Private Practice Clinics,
Fitness and Wellness Centers,
Corporate Wellness Programs,
NGOs
| Hiring Sector/Type | Common Roles | Approx. Starting Salary (Monthly) |
|---|
| Multi-specialty Hospitals | Specialized Physiotherapist | INR 40,000 - 80,000 |
| Rehabilitation Centers | Rehab Specialist | INR 35,000 - 70,000 |
| Sports Clinics/Teams | Sports Physiotherapist | INR 50,000 - 90,000 |
| Own Practice | Clinic Owner/Lead Physiotherapist | Variable (High potential) |
| Corporate Wellness | Ergonomist/Wellness Consultant | INR 45,000 - 85,000 |
Government Sector Jobs
Graduates are eligible for exams conducted by:
Central Government Hospitals (e.g., CGHS),
State Government Hospitals,
Armed Forces Medical Services,
Public Sector Undertaking (PSU) Hospitals,
Municipal Corporations,
Sports Authority of India (SAI)
| Recruiting Body | Typical Roles | Approx. Salary (Monthly) |
|---|
| Central Govt. Hospitals | Physiotherapist, Senior Physiotherapist | INR 60,000 - 1,20,000 |
| State Govt. Hospitals | District Physiotherapist, Medical Officer (Physiotherapy) | INR 50,000 - 1,00,000 |
| Armed Forces | Medical Assistant (Physiotherapy) | INR 70,000 - 1,50,000 |
| SAI | Sports Physiotherapist | INR 75,000 - 1,30,000 |
IndCareer Editorial Take
Ideal Candidate:
A candidate with a strong academic record in BPT, excellent communication and interpersonal skills, a passion for evidence-based practice, and a desire to specialize and contribute to patient well-being. Empathy and physical stamina are crucial.
Critical Checks before Admission:
- Verify the UGC/AICTE/Relevant Council approval of the institute and the specific MPT program.
- Check the faculty-to-student ratio and their qualifications.
- Understand the specialization options offered and their relevance to career goals.
- Inquire about clinical tie-ups and mandatory internship duration/locations.
Common Misconceptions:
Some may believe MPT is only for those who want to teach or do research; in reality, it's essential for advancing clinical practice and accessing specialized roles in hospitals and private settings.
State-Specific Note:
Admission processes and fee structures can vary significantly by state. Some states have centralized counseling for government and private medical/paramedical colleges.
